What the school offers its staff

We can offer you

• A supportive staff, parent and governor community plus fantastic, hardworking children. The class are an absolute delight.
• Weekly PPA time with your year group and ongoing professional development, including additional release time/training opportunities. You’d actually only be teaching 2.5 days!
• The chance to work in partnership with experienced colleagues. The job share for the class is our Assistant Head and they are on school every day, helping to facilitate an excellent handover.
• An exciting curriculum to teach, which is planned collaboratively. We are always eager to take on new ideas too and are proud to offer learning through initiatives such as Let’s Think in English.
• A positive school community, where teamwork is a real strength and staff wellbeing is important. We have high expectations of both children and our staff but also believe that everyone’s experience of school should be successful and memorable too!
• A very well-resourced school with extensive grounds, Forest School and excellent facilities for learning.
